The Sunday Assembly has launched new services in 35 cities across the world - the largest expansion yet of their 'atheist churches'.

Started in January 2013 by British comedians Sanderson Jones and Pippa Evans, the Sunday Assembly seeks to offer the communal, uplifting aspect of church, without any of the God business.

The US has proved one of the most fertile markets for the Sunday Assembly, with 11 cities already hosting events and another 16 launching new services as part of the latest expansion.

The Guardian sent Adam Gabbatt to the first service in Cleveland, Ohio, to find out how a godless church works.
